To avoid buckling subfloor panels should be spaced with a 1 8 inch gap at all edges and ends to provide room for naturally occurring expansion.
Whether you screw nail or staple your 3 8ths underlayment depends completely upon what flooring product you are planning to put over it.
The purpose of an underlayment for vinyl is to have a glass smooth surface to glue to 1 4 ply is the industry standard whereas an underlayment for ceramic tile is to add strength and 3 8ths isn t thick.
